Transaction 240112d914060dc8882a09ffcec73419533404b11ebb8b430e39ba4361ac371a
1 Input
-
31b27e8b367150d530cb22eb459075cabc146b906620e073a8926f51395018e4:0
OP_DATA_48(48) 45022100d827a4f4efbc45f9d4967187f0f28a9192039eacffc6ac13a77d0050c34e2ddc02205d370451e17cd0f6d55e
1 Outputs
- 240112d914060dc8882a09ffcec73419533404b11ebb8b430e39ba4361ac371a:0
value 249290
address 37WMoPKYvH43FgCgAvBSQaVo3KtAiALZ1a